I just got the HPS10SE also and don't know how to use it to check for clipping..... any tips?

EDIT: Clip your probe to a + output and the ground clip to the -. Or if you're doing RCAs take the clip off and wedge the tip into the split in your RCA's tip if it has one, otherwise you'll just have to hold it :P

Set the time/div to 10ms then set the volt/div to like 10V if you're doing amplifier outputs or 200mV if you're doing RCAs.

Play a suitable tone on repeat, turn it up until you see the wave become square. You can let it get a litttttle bit square, it's only like 2% THD and you can get a lot more power by just allowing it to square off a tiny bit and you'll almost never notice the difference.

Make sure you do it with your subs/speakers connected otherwise you don't get an accurate idea of what your amps will output when loaded :)
